    Dynatrace, the global leader in Software Intelligence, is looking for a Senior CRM Program Manager to join our dynamic and motivated Sales Operations team.

    We need a smart, roll-up your sleeves type of individual who is willing to go the extra mile to support our growing sales team in the following capacities:

    Job Responsibilities

    Lead strategic projects supporting GTM vision for Sales organization

    Build and execute a vision for Salesforce to improve deal execution which drives increased efficiency for our Sales and supporting organizations

    Strategize end-state vision and implementation timeline for Salesforce CRM capabilities to support Dynatrace's rapid expansion

    Align with Business Systems leadership to define, prioritize and plan necessary SFDC improvements which drive a future state scalable vision, and coordinate with team to execute said priorities

    Develop working model with leadership from other Sales facing teams (finance, partner, sales enablement, etc) to ensure effective partnerships across our organizations

    Define best-in-class Sales focused processes built on SFDC functionalities that enable an effective multi-faceted SaaS business model

    Qualifications


    Minimum Qualifications:
    Minimum expectation of a Bachelor's Degree

    8+ years Sales Operations CRM experience required


    Preferred Qualifications:
    Bachelor's Degree in Business Administration, Finance, or similar field

    Experience in SaaS specific software and process requirements

    Sales Operations CRM experience with platform

    certification

    Excellent written and verbal communication skills, effective leadership, and ability to guide all levels of the organization through a vision to execution

    Proven track record of leading organizations through significant software implementations

    Compensation and rewards

    The base salary range for this role is $120,000 to $140,000. When determining your salary, we consider your experience, skills and education, and work location.

    Our total compensation package includes unlimited personal time off, an employee stock purchase plan, and a reward system.

    We also offer medical/dental benefits, and a company matching 401(k) plan for retirement.
